Output 8f69939fb5433cb379814f08fcb373abe6da4305c280bc3db984976730433952:0

value
1388600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a5cbd1d4e51c2615ff04df1a2dd412e5eaacd98 OP_EQUAL
address
3QWox6pbp14TQVsXY63HJ6hUQkGdsAh2Ug
transaction
8f69939fb5433cb379814f08fcb373abe6da4305c280bc3db984976730433952
confirmations
393705
spent
true